What's Actually Holding Back Retail AI Success?

The obstacles preventing CPG and retail organizations from converting AI ambition into commercial impact are surprisingly consistent across the industry. Rather than technical limitations, the biggest risks stem from fragmented strategy, poor data quality, legacy technology constraints, cost uncertainty, talent gaps, ethical exposure, and weak change management. When executives evaluate AI investments, they often focus on whether the technology can generate more activity, but the real question should be whether it can improve profitability, conversion, and responsiveness across the entire shopper journey.

Three major categories of barriers emerge repeatedly in industry discussions:

  • Data and Technical Hurdles: Incomplete, messy, or siloed data across supply chains leads to weak demand forecasts and poor insights. Legacy systems and outdated software cannot easily support modern, real-time AI tools, and delays in capturing point-of-sale or in-store inventory metrics slow down automated decision-making.
  • Financial and Operational Barriers: Initial investments for custom AI models, cloud infrastructure, and physical automation are expensive. Managing thousands of distinct retail outlets, shifting distribution channels, and fast-changing consumer habits complicates deployment, while companies struggle to train employees and update everyday workflows to embrace AI-driven processes.
  • Trust, Ethics, and Security: Protecting sensitive shopper data from breaches remains a constant risk. Flawed models can cause unfair pricing, bad product recommendations, or discriminatory marketing, which could lead to loss of competitive advantage or even discriminatory lawsuits.

Where Are Companies Actually Seeing Returns on AI Investment?

The companies achieving measurable ROI are focusing on high-value use cases with clear business impact. Research shows that the fastest returns on investment are generated in three specific areas: dynamic route optimization, AI-driven demand forecasting, and freight documentation automation. In logistics specifically, dynamic route optimization has helped companies reduce fuel consumption by 15 to 20 percent, improve delivery speed by 15 to 25 percent, lower transportation costs by 12 to 22 percent, and reduce operating costs by 12 to 20 percent, with many projects achieving payback within 3 to 6 months.

For demand forecasting, AI-driven systems have reduced forecast errors by 20 to 40 percent and improved forecasting accuracy by as much as 35 percent, while lowering inventory levels by 20 to 30 percent, typically delivering measurable benefits within 6 to 12 months. Freight documentation automation has reduced manual processing time by up to 85 percent, significantly improving productivity while achieving return on investment within 3 to 6 months.

Across early adopters, AI-enabled supply chain programs are delivering average logistics and operational cost reductions of 10 to 25 percent, lowering forecast errors by 20 to 40 percent, and increasing warehouse productivity by 25 to 35 percent within the first year of deployment. These results demonstrate that when AI is applied strategically to specific business problems, the financial case becomes compelling and the payback timeline becomes measured in months, not years.

How to Scale AI Deliberately Across Your Organization

  • Start with Focused Pilots: Begin with high-value use cases that prove ROI before attempting enterprise-wide rollout. Prioritize personalization, inventory optimization, revenue growth management, customer support, and operational efficiency based on your specific business model and competitive priorities.
  • Modernize Data and Systems in Parallel: Implement strong data governance, scalable cloud-enabled architecture, and responsible AI practices that protect customer trust. Clean data and modern infrastructure are prerequisites for scaling AI beyond initial experiments.
  • Build Organizational Readiness Through Training and Engagement: Invest in employee training and stakeholder engagement to ensure your workforce can absorb and apply new AI-enabled processes. Most CPG and retail executives need natural language tools and accessible platforms, not complex technical interfaces.
  • Avoid Applying AI Where Simpler Solutions Will Do: Not every business problem requires artificial intelligence. Evaluate whether AI genuinely solves the problem better than existing approaches before committing resources and organizational change.

Companies that pair ambition with governance, clean data, scalable platforms, and change leadership will be better positioned to convert AI from a technology initiative into a durable source of growth and competitive advantage.

The Workforce Adoption Problem Nobody's Talking About

While most discussions focus on technology and data, a critical measurement gap exists around workforce adoption and capability. A new approach to AI ROI measurement is emerging that connects workforce adoption, capability, behavior, and capacity to organizational performance. Traditional ROI measures remain essential for evaluating cost savings, productivity, revenue, and efficiency, but they cannot tell leaders everything happening between deploying AI and realizing enterprise value.

The distinction matters because a high active-user rate can demonstrate utilization without revealing whether employees are becoming more proficient or applying AI to higher-value work. Training completion confirms that learning was delivered, but not necessarily that new capabilities are being productively applied. Hours saved can indicate potential efficiency without showing whether that time is being converted into usable organizational capacity or improved performance.

When AI adoption falls below expectations, organizations may interpret the problem as employee resistance or a lack of training. However, the actual root cause may be that employees lack a particular capability, an existing process makes the AI-enabled workflow impractical, leadership expectations are unclear, competing priorities constrain adoption, employees revert to established behaviors under pressure, or the workforce lacks the capacity to absorb continued transformation.
